## Formula sandbox tuning

User-supplied formulas in Gridmoor execute inside a restricted interpreter with hard ceilings on time, memory, and call depth. Reviewers should confirm any change to these ceilings is justified in the PR description, since raising them widens the abuse surface. Defaults were chosen from production traces. The current limits are as follows.

limits module of tafog-fawip:
WEIGHTS = {
    "julix": 57,
    "lamys": 992,
    "kasvan": 209,
    "quenok": 750,
    "alddor": 259,
    "oliath": 1009,
    "wenix": 815,
}

- [ ] CSV import wizard: verify the Quillbury importer rejects rows with mismatched column counts rather than silently padding them, and that the preview step shows the first twenty parse errors with line numbers. Confirm encoding detection falls back to the user's declared charset, not a guess, and that a failed import leaves no partial records behind. Reviewer sign-off requires testing against the malformed-fixtures bundle. Record your approval against the build token printed below.

session token of kafof-kafop = htk31_c3becf8b8eac3ed970037fba36e258e

= Document Transport: Paper Ledger Archiving =

All paper ledgers from the Marrowfield site are archived quarterly at the Dunlea Vault. Ledgers must be banded by year, placed spine-up in the lined archive cartons, and each carton sealed with two tamper strips. Record carton counts in the transport log before the Kestrel Freight van arrives. Cartons travel on a single pallet, shrink-wrapped, never mixed with general stock. At collection, verify the driver presents the signed Dunlea manifest.

handover note for tadug-yaguf: the aldath pelwyn courier leaves the casox norwyn briix silok zorok kasdor aldion quenox ledger at gate 2653 under passcode 959015